Subject: Regional Sales Review — Quick Heads-Up

Hi all,

With Dana Elverton joining us next month as incoming director, I wanted to get the regional review on everyone's radar early. The Kestrel Coast territory outperformed again, while Northvale slipped for the second quarter running — mostly churn on the Brightline Pro tier. We'll walk through the full numbers Thursday, but Dana should see the headline picture before then. One item shouldn't leave this group, so keeping it brief here. The confidential summary of our plans follows below.

board note of bawep-tajef: Queniusek Systems plans to raise the Quenvan list price by 53.1 percent in March. The pricing group signed off on a budget of $176.4 million for Project Drueth. The renewal with Casionix Partners closes at $142.5 million a year, 8.3 percent below the last contract. Project Fraax slips by six weeks because of the tooling delay.

Ticket SHP-914 — Lanterly parcel-tracking webhook dropping delivery events. Carrier callbacks return 200 but events never reach the status table; suspect the dedupe layer is eating retries after the schema change. On-call: replay the last hour from the dead-letter queue and confirm rows land. No customer comms yet. Escalate if replay fails twice. Check the replay worker against the trace token below.

session token of yajof-bagef = htk4_937d

# Undo/redo settings for the Sketchloom diagram editor.
# History depth is capped at 200 steps per canvas; raising it
# increases memory use noticeably on large org charts, so warn
# customers before changing it. Undo history is persisted
# server-side so sessions survive crashes. The history store is
# reached via the connection string below.

primary connection of yagep-kahip = redis://giliel_svc:zYiKsLL2PLpfPL@db-348f.xolmarsys.corp:5432/fenwyn